8In the Other Querier Present Interval box, specify how long (1 to 65,535 seconds) the WX switch waits for a general query to arrive before making itself the querier. The default interval is 255 seconds.

9In the Query Response Interval box, specify how long (1 to 65,535 tenths of a second) a device can take to respond to an IGMP query. The default interval is 100 tenths of a second (10 seconds).

10In the Last Member Query Interval box, specify how long (1 to 65,535 tenths of a second) the WX switch waits for a response to a group query, after receiving a leave message for that group, before removing the group. The default value is 10 tenths of a second (1 second).

11In the Robustness Value box, specify the robustness value (2 to 255), which sets IGMP timers to adjust to the amount of traffic loss on the network. Set the robustness value higher to adjust for more traffic loss. The default is 2.

12To enable proxy reporting, which summarizes collected station IGMP reports, select Proxy Report.

13To enable multicast router solicitation, which allows the WX to discover multicast routers on the subnet, select Multicast Router Solicitation.

14In the Solicitation Interval box, specify the interval (1 to 65,535 seconds) between multicast router solicitations by a WX. The default interval is 30 seconds.

15Click OK.

Configuring Static Multicast Ports

A WX learns about multicast routers and receivers from multicast traffic received from those devices. When the WX receives traffic from a multicast router or receiver, the WX adds the port that received the traffic as a multicast router or receiver port. The WX forwards traffic to multicast routers only on the multicast router ports and forwards traffic to multicast receivers only on the multicast receiver ports.

The router and receiver ports that the WX learns based on multicast traffic age out if they are unused. If necessary, you can statically configure multicast router ports or multicast receiver ports on the WX.

You can only add network ports as static multicast router ports or multicast receiver ports. Ports you add are immediately added to the list and do not age out.
